For all those who have a reliance wimax broadband connection, try the following out:
1) go to
start > control panel > network connections > then goto properties of the local area connection (ur lan card properties) > click on internet protocol (tcp/ip) > properties > and set the static ip 192.168.1.22 in use the following ip address dialog box.
2) now start ur lan connection, by right click on it and select enable.
3) now go to
start > run > cmd [press ok]
4) now type there
c:\> telnet 192.168.1.1 if it fails then telnet 192.168.0.1
now u should have shell,
asking for
username and password.,
enter
username : support
password : support
5) now u have access to the wimax antenna via telnet then type
sh bs[hit enter]
it will show u something useful data,
like signal strength and frequency,
so move ur antenna if u getting weak signal slightly,
and again type
sh bs
u will notice some changes their, do this procedure till u get high signal,
each time u move your antenna give again command sh bs [enter]
